WebYou do not need a webcam in order to join a Zoom meeting or webinar. However, without a webcam, you will not be able to enable video. WebNov 6, 2024 · Desktop PCs tend to lack a camera since the camera is a feature of the monitor and not particularly that of the actual computer. There are some certain all-in-one computers with a built-in camera.
